Market Ecosystem and Operational Framework Key Product Categories Standard Self-Dispersing Silicone Antifoams: Widely used across industries for general foam control applications. High-Performance Variants: Designed for extreme conditions such as high temperature or aggressive chemical environments. Eco-Friendly Formulations: Biodegradable and non-toxic options targeting environmentally sensitive sectors. Stakeholders and Demand-Supply Framework Raw Material Suppliers: Silicone monomers, emulsifiers, and dispersants sourced globally, with key suppliers in China, Japan, and Europe. Manufacturers: Both multinational corporations and regional players producing self-dispersing silicone antifoams, often integrating R&D for customized solutions. Distributors and Agents: Regional distributors facilitate market penetration, especially in niche sectors. End-Users: Chemical producers, pulp & paper mills, textile manufacturers, food & beverage processors, and wastewater treatment plants. Value Chain and Revenue Models Raw Material Sourcing: Suppliers generate revenue via bulk sales of silicone monomers and dispersants, often through long-term contracts. Manufacturing: Value addition occurs through formulation, blending, and quality assurance, with revenue derived from product sales and customized formulations. Distribution & Logistics: Margins are maintained via regional distribution networks, with value added through technical support and after-sales services. End-User Delivery & Lifecycle Services: Revenue streams include product sales, technical consulting, and maintenance contracts, with lifecycle management ensuring repeat business and customer retention. Cost Structures, Pricing Strategies, and Risk Factors Cost Structures: Raw materials constitute approximately 50–60% of manufacturing costs, with R&D and quality control accounting for another 15–20%. Manufacturing economies of scale are crucial for maintaining competitive pricing. Pricing Strategies: Premium pricing is adopted for high-performance and eco-friendly variants, while standard formulations compete on cost-efficiency. Volume discounts and long-term contracts are common to secure market share. Adoption Trends and End-User Insights In South Korea, the chemical industry remains the largest consumer, accounting for over 40% of demand, driven by high-volume applications in wastewater treatment and process chemicals. The pulp & paper sector is also expanding, with foam control solutions improving process efficiency and reducing environmental footprint. Emerging sectors such as food processing and textiles are witnessing incremental adoption, primarily driven by regulatory pressures and sustainability initiatives. Real-world use cases include foam suppression in pulp bleaching processes and anti-foaming in beverage manufacturing, illustrating shifting consumption patterns toward high-performance, eco-friendly formulations.
